USPTO Abstract
An aspect of the invention provides a tearable package (10) for a pharmaceutical product (40) including: (i) a first layer (12) including a sheet of flexible material; (ii) a second layer (14) including a sheet of flexible material; the layers being overlaid and fused together at a perimetrical sealing region (20), the fused layers (12,14) defining a cavity (16) therebetween for the storage of the pharmaceutical product (40); wherein one of the layers (12) has a discontinuous region (30) in the sealing region (20); and wherein the package (10) may be folded through the discontinuous region (30) to be torn such that the pharmaceutical contents may be removed.
